What Are the Most Common Pedestrian Accident Injuries?
The most common pedestrian accident injuries include head trauma, broken bones, and spinal cord damage. Pedestrians are significantly more exposed to injury in accidents due to their complete lack of physical protection compared to vehicle occupants. What Is the Average Payout for a Pedestrian Hit by a Car?
There is no average payout for a pedestrian hit by a car because settlements vary widely depending on the details of each crash. The compensation will be based on the severity of the injuries, the circumstances of the accident, and the insurance coverage involved. How Long Does it Take to Settle a Pedestrian Accident?
It will likely take anywhere from a few months to several years to settle a pedestrian accident. How long it takes to settle your accident case depends on your losses and other factors. Who Is at Fault in a Pedestrian Accident in Massachusetts?
Many parties could be at fault in a pedestrian accident in Massachusetts. While a driver is often liable, depending on the details of the incident, other parties could be responsible, including a cyclist and the municipality.
